Output c2c21bf946d75790749ee568c82e2efdddb860166889315e16c4db8611598800:1

value
19268671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d5053a215c1029e54eb0f7a544243c8f5accdd OP_EQUAL
address
3DteyyXHcfdgHZy7B42sBHviSkkiZTeJWy
transaction
c2c21bf946d75790749ee568c82e2efdddb860166889315e16c4db8611598800
confirmations
312430
spent
true